Ordinals
beta
Sat 1681644885412528
decimal
505315.1135412528
degree
0°85315′1315″1135412528‴
percentile
80.07832796487324%
name
byaigdllnef
cycle
0
epoch
2
period
250
block
505315
offset
1135412528
timestamp
2018-01-21 08:18:50 UTC
rarity
common
prev
next